Ben Sherman Blue Leather Watch

£72.00
£80.00
£72.00

By placing your order you agree to the Terms Of Services

Free standard delivery on all orders

Ben Sherman Blue Leather Watch

Ben Sherman Blue Leather Watch

£80.00 £72.00

Ben Sherman Blue Leather Watch

£80.00 £72.00

You May Also Like

Recently Viewed

Cursor